BLS metro-level wage data places Special Effects Artists and Animators pay in Sacramento-Roseville-Folsom, CA at a median of $122,880 per year ($59.08/hr/hour), drawn from the OEWS May 2025 release for this Metropolitan Statistical Area. Compared to the national median of $102,030, Sacramento-Roseville-Folsom pays +20% above, signaling either concentrated employer demand, a cost-of-living premium, or both. Approximately 70 special effects artists and animatorss are employed across the Sacramento-Roseville-Folsom MSA in SOC 27-1014.

The Sacramento-Roseville-Folsom pay distribution spans from $72,640 at the 10th percentile to $167,980 at the 90th — a 2.3× spread that reflects experience tenure, specialization, employer size, and the difference between public-sector, nonprofit, and private-sector compensation inside the metro. The 25th percentile sits at $87,900 and the 75th at $147,880, so half of Sacramento-Roseville-Folsom-based special effects artists and animatorss earn within that middle band.

Metro figures capture where you actually work, not just where you live — which matters for commuters. BLS draws metro boundaries from the OMB MSA definitions, so Sacramento-Roseville-Folsom, CA covers the central city plus outlying counties tied to the metro economically. Remember that OEWS wages reflect base pay only: employer-provided health insurance, retirement matches, stock options, signing bonuses, overtime, and tips are excluded and can add 20-40% to real total compensation.
